Mike Tyson Says He Smoked Marijuana Before Fight vs. Roy Jones Jr.: ‘It’s Just Who I Am’
Mike Tyson says that before making his official return to the ring, he smoked marijuana.
As you know, the 54-year-old former boxing champion fought Roy Jones Jr. Saturday night and he shared that before fighting, he smoked weed. During his post fight press conference he was asked whether or not he did and he responded:
“Absolutely, yes”.
He explained,
“Listen, I can’t stop smoking. I smoked during fights. I just have to smoke, I’m sorry. I’m a smoker. … I smoke everyday. I never stopped smoking.”
Mike Tyson explains that marijuana doesn’t have a negative affect on him.
“It’s just who I am. It has no effect on me from a negative standpoint. It’s just what I do and how I am and how I’m going to die. There’s no explanation. There’s no beginning, there’s no end.”
When asked if marijuana helps numb the pain he responds,
“No, it just numbs me. It doesn’t numb the pain.”
